Ken Baksh October 2019 Market Report
During one-month period to 30th September 2019, major equity markets registered reasonable gains. The FTSE ALL-World Index rose by 2.25% over the period, now up by 14.71% since the beginning of the year. The VIX index fell by 10.3% to end the period at 16.55. Ken Baksh September 2019 Market Report
During one-month period to 31st August 2019, major equity markets registered quite sharp falls. The FTSE ALL-World Index dropped by 3.62% over the period, though still up by 12.2% since the beginning of the year. The VIX index rose sharply by 34.8% to end the period at 18.45. BLUEFOLD SOLAR INCOME FUND (BSIF) Renewables have grown to a large investment trust sector in a relatively short period of time. They have unique characteristics (RPI linked dividends, high proportion of regulated cash flows, direct exposure to power prices) and have delivered good total returns to investors, often bearing little correlation to other asset classes.
